League of Legends Ping Test: Why High Ping Happens and How to Fix It
A League of Legends ping test is useful when the game feels delayed, but the number alone does not explain the cause. High ping can come from ISP routing, Wi-Fi interference, router overload, local congestion, or server-side issues. This article breaks down the symptoms, shows how to isolate each cause, and outlines realistic fixes for broadband users.
What a High Ping Test Usually Means
If a League of Legends ping test shows unusually high latency, the result often reflects delay between your device and the game server rather than raw internet speed. In practice, that delay can come from congestion, wireless instability, routing problems, or a local network device that is struggling to keep up.
Ping is only one part of the experience. A connection can have strong download and upload rates and still feel slow in game if latency is inconsistent or packets are being delayed along the path.
Common Cause 1: ISP Routing and Network Congestion
One of the most common reasons for high ping is the route your ISP uses to reach the game server. Even on fiber or cable broadband, traffic may take a longer or more congested path than expected, especially during peak hours.
If latency rises at busy times of day but improves late at night, the issue may be upstream congestion rather than your home setup. In that case, switching DNS alone usually will not solve the problem because the bottleneck is outside your network.
Common Cause 2: Wi-Fi Interference or Weak Signal
Wireless connections are convenient, but they are also more vulnerable to interference from walls, distance, neighboring networks, and household devices. A weak Wi-Fi signal can create jitter, retransmissions, and short spikes in ping that make gameplay feel unstable.
If the problem appears only on Wi-Fi and improves on Ethernet, the wireless link is the likely cause. This is especially common on crowded 2.4 GHz networks or when the gaming device is far from the router.
Common Cause 3: Router or Modem Overload
Older routers and modems can become a hidden bottleneck when many devices are active at once. Video calls, streaming, cloud backups, and large downloads can consume buffer space and delay game packets even if the connection speed looks adequate.
Firmware issues and poor queue handling can also create latency spikes. If your router is several years old, or if ping gets worse when other people in the home are online, the local hardware may be part of the problem.
Common Cause 4: Server Region, Match Path, or DNS Issues
Sometimes the ping problem is not inside your home network at all. If your game client is connected to a distant region, the packet path will naturally be longer. In other cases, the route between your ISP and the Riot server may be inefficient even when the selected region is correct.
DNS changes rarely reduce in-game ping by themselves, but they can help with initial connection reliability or service discovery. The main issue for latency is usually the actual network path, not name resolution.
How to Tell Where the Delay Starts
The fastest way to diagnose the problem is to compare several test points. Run a ping test to your router, then to a public endpoint, then compare that with the in-game latency value. If the ping to your router is unstable, the issue is local. If the router is stable but the public test is not, the ISP path is more likely.
- Test on Ethernet first to remove Wi-Fi from the equation.
- Check whether ping spikes happen during downloads or streaming.
- Compare results at different times of day.
- Watch for packet loss, not just average latency.
Consistent spikes usually matter more than the average number. A stable 50 ms connection can feel better than a connection that jumps between 20 ms and 120 ms.
Practical Fixes That Often Help
Start with the simplest changes: use Ethernet, move closer to the router if Wi-Fi is required, and pause heavy background traffic. If possible, reboot the modem and router to clear temporary faults and refresh the network path.
- Use a wired connection for gaming.
- Place the router in an open central location.
- Switch to 5 GHz Wi-Fi if the signal is strong enough.
- Update router firmware and network drivers.
- Enable quality of service if your router handles it well.
- Contact your ISP if latency spikes persist across multiple devices and times of day.
If the connection remains unstable after these steps, the best next move is to isolate each layer separately: device, router, home wiring, and ISP. That approach is more effective than changing settings at random.
When Hardware or the ISP Needs Attention
If your ping test is consistently poor even on Ethernet and after a restart, the problem may be the modem, the router, or the ISP line itself. Cable broadband can be sensitive to neighborhood congestion, while older DSL lines may show higher baseline latency. Fiber usually performs better, but it can still suffer from routing or equipment issues.
At that point, collect a few measurements with timestamps and contact support with specific details. Clear evidence makes it easier to determine whether the fault is local, regional, or tied to a broader network issue.
